Output 140ba83e24db999aab4083d062be2240c17e2d575eff46d3d3694a3e256fce3e:0

value
484151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 829bd6a9b7e7ac6dd3db972c8797056559dd84f9 OP_EQUAL
address
3DbcTLETU5ibPRmdyokyY5rXHjmPzyFknR
transaction
140ba83e24db999aab4083d062be2240c17e2d575eff46d3d3694a3e256fce3e
confirmations
148270
spent
true